Where is Crooked Water Spirits Of The North vodka made?
Crooked Water Spirits Of The North vodka is produced in Osakis, Minnesota. The distillery, Panther Distillery, LLC, holds the TTB basic permit for the brand. According to TTB COLA records, Crooked Water Spirits Of The North vodka appears on 1 approved label.
Who makes Crooked Water Spirits Of The North vodka and who owns the brand?
The basic permit holder is Panther Distillery, LLC. According to TTB COLA records, Panther Distillery, LLC holds the basic permit under which Crooked Water Spirits Of The North labels are approved. Parent-company ownership is not part of TTB public filings and is not included here.
What proof is Crooked Water Spirits Of The North vodka?
Crooked Water Spirits Of The North vodka is bottled at 80-89 proof (40-44.5% ABV). According to TTB COLA records, these proof values are drawn from approved label filings.
